Output 17c244b5276dda34e180c66b853e83358f28ffced8c2089bb61372298269a71e:0

value
103122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875d56b0bfde3d5776c148a7917f7d5821d306a5 OP_EQUAL
address
3E2kxit229kF8bEtoHm81kynohuVh9gHZM
transaction
17c244b5276dda34e180c66b853e83358f28ffced8c2089bb61372298269a71e